Because people say, oh, I jog or I play golf.
Well, if somebody is giving you hell or your kids are screaming, are you going to start jogging?
So when I'm in this situation, I can pull down my cortisol, only because I exercise certain parts.
And it's going back and forth, thoughts back to the sense, thoughts back.
Even two minutes a day, those parts will get... If you do five sit-ups a day, it'll take longer to get a six-pack.
But eventually, you'll have it.
So people say, how long does it take?
Well, do three minutes a day.
But it's a specific exercise.
It isn't just sitting there breathing.
You're training your body like you would a wild animal.
Like you would a child having a hissy fit.
You're training it.
You're giving it an anchor.
Otherwise, your thoughts will think about thoughts.
They'll think about thoughts.
When we ruminate, that's what wipes us out.
That's what frazzled means.
Frazzled doesn't mean stress.
It means stress about stress.
